This may be a request for a feature, if I understand how this works correctly:
For the Dartware probes that also get traffic values... I keep forgetting what the percentage trigger is for utilization? Also what level of alert does this trigger? "Critical", "Alarm", or "Warning" (also would be nice to have control over setting the percentage, sort of like how we change the Interface errors...). OK Interface errors threshold. We can set this at server, map, or device level for values that would trigger warning, alarm, or critical. Is it correct that the "Interface errors" threshold is either the error or discards counters per minute? If the "Interface errors" counters is either errors or discards per minute - I see a problem with this. It is possible (and we have this condition going on now), where because of overloaded links we get a large amount of discards, and until the links are upgraded to higher bandwith we have adjusted the threshold up to 10,000 per minute. This is great for discards, allows us to work on only the most overload links first. The problem is with the threshold set so high for critical, we never get critical alerts for "errors per minute". If we see interface errors we want to get alerted as critical also but for a lower threshold, since any errors usually indicate a more serious problem. So is there a way to set the errors per minute threshold different from discards per minute, if not can this be considered for a feature request?
